Light Activity Dates for Casual Curiosity: Easy Exit Plans in بلدية الشيحانية

For dating in بلدية الشيحانية, a light activity date can be more useful when an easy exit plan supports casual curiosity. An easy exit plan can make a first meeting feel safer and more respectful. A light plan can respect curiosity without pretending the connection is already defined.

  1. Shape the plan: Pick an easy activity that gives both people something to react to without making the activity the whole point.
  2. Protect comfort: Choose a format with a natural endpoint so either person can leave kindly if the chemistry is not there.
  3. Use the chat well: Ask playful but thoughtful questions that help you understand personality and intent.
  4. Know what to avoid: Avoid open-ended plans that make someone feel trapped or rude for ending the date.

If trust is still forming, choose a public plan that makes boundaries easy to discuss. A date in بلدية الشيحانية does not need to answer everything at once. It only needs to help two people notice whether comfort, curiosity, and communication are moving in the same direction.

Chemistry Check: Meaningful Compatibility For Jewish Singles

If the spark is real, that’s a great start—but attraction alone doesn’t answer whether a relationship will fit your life. Use this chemistry check to explore values, routines, and goals with care and curiosity.

Talk About Values And Life Priorities

Start with open, nonjudgmental questions about what matters most. Ask about family traditions, religious observance, views on marriage and children, and how each of you balances work, social life, and personal time. Listen for what feels essential versus flexible—shared core values help sustain a relationship through change.

Check Lifestyle Fit

Practical compatibility keeps daily life smooth. Compare routines (early riser vs. night owl), social habits (homebody vs. frequent socializer), finances (saving priorities, attitudes toward debt), and living preferences (city vs. suburbs, travel frequency). Small mismatches can be negotiated, but repeated friction in everyday habits is draining if unaddressed.

Clarify Relationship Goals

Be direct about timelines and intentions without pressuring the other person. Are you both exploring casually, dating with the aim of long-term commitment, or interested in marriage soon? If being part of a Jewish community, raising children with particular traditions, or interfaith considerations matter to you, bring these topics up early so expectations align.

Notice Communication Style And Conflict Habits

Pay attention to how you handle discomfort. Do you both prefer to address issues immediately, or do you need space before talking? Discuss how you give and receive feedback, what feels respectful, and what kinds of comments cross boundaries. Healthy communication is less about matching styles perfectly and more about willingness to adapt and repair.

Respect Boundaries And Cultural Nuance

Boundaries—emotional, physical, and cultural—are personal. Ask about comfort levels around public displays of affection, meeting extended family, holiday observance, and how much each person wants to share about faith and private practices. Respectful questions show care and help both people feel safe.

Sample Questions To Guide The Conversation

  • What family traditions or holidays do you look forward to most, and why?
  • How do you imagine balancing career, family, and personal time in a committed relationship?
  • What role does faith or cultural practice play in your everyday life?
  • How do you prefer to handle disagreements—talk it through immediately or take time to cool off?
  • What are your thoughts about children, parenting, or blending traditions?
  • What boundaries are important to you early in a relationship?
